Koh Pha Ngan ranked best place to work in the world

Open your suitcases and your chakras – Koh Pha Ngan has been ranked as the top destination for a workout – an increasingly popular way to sneak into a getaway while still working. The popular tourist island in Surat Thani province in southern Thailand ranks first out of 16 choices compiled and analyzed by William Russell, a prominent health, life and income insurer.
The list was calculated taking into account 4 main factors that are important for someone trying to vacation while working: accommodation costs, internet speed, safety and, of course, fun. . Koh Pha Ngan, known for its spiritualistic and hippy new age northern shores as well as the world famous wild and drunken Full Moon Party in the south of the island, edged out Spain’s Gran Canaria to take the top job spot.
The Spanish island was ranked second while Portugal’s capital Lisbon captured third place on Russell’s list. Austin, Texas, and Sao Paulo, Brazil round out the top 5. Koh Pha Ngan achieved the top job ranking by being highly rated both in terms of safety and fun, as well as having the second cheapest monthly cost of living, calculated at 1051 USD, only Buenos Aires , in Argentina, being considered cheaper. But Pha Ngan’s internet speed, calculated at 24 Mbps (we assume between fairly frequent planned power outages on the island), is 4 times faster than Argentinian speeds and considered sufficient for online work.

The top 10 locations for a job and their details are:
Rank | City Country | Monthly cost | the Internet | Fun | Security |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
1 | Koh Pha Ngan, Thailand | $1,051 | Fast: 24 Mbps | Great | Great |
2 | Gran Canaria, Spain | $1,789 | Fast: 35 Mbps | Good | Great |
3 | Lisbon, Portugal | $2,429 | Fast: 28 Mbps | Great | Great |
4 | Austin, TX, USA | $3,797 | Super fast: 76 Mbps | Great | Good |
5 | Sao Paulo, Brazil | $1,495 | Good: 6 Mbps | Great | Ok |
6 | Budapest, Hungary | $1,637 | Fast: 30 Mbps | Good | Good |
seven | Canggu, Bali, Indonesia | $1,411 | Fast: 25 Mbps | Good | Great |
8 | Belgrade, Serbia | $1,555 | Fast: 27 Mbps | Good | Good |
9 | Berlin, Germany | $3,465 | Fast: 27 Mbps | Good | Great |
ten | Buenos Aires, Argentina | $904 | Good: 6 Mbps | Good | Ok |
